The polite ~ます-masu form has an い i sound (i, chi, ri, ki, gi, ni, bi, mi, shi) The negative form has an あ a sound (wa, ta, ra, ka, ga, na, ba, ma, sa) The potential form has an え e sound (e, te, re, ke, ge, ne, be, me, se) The volitional form has an おう ō sound (ō, tō, rō, kō, gō, nō, bō, mō, sō). The causative forms are characterized by the final u becoming aseru for consonant stem verbs, and ru becoming saseru for vowel stem verbs. tsu, taseru, matsu (wait), mataseru masu stem, mase, irasshaimasu (come, go), irasshaimase
